Swordsmen in Double Flag Town (双旗镇刀客), also known as The Swordsman in Double Flag Town, is a 1991 Chinese film directed by He Ping, starring Gao Yiwei, Zhang Mana, Chang Jiang, and Sun Haiying. The film is a mix of the wuxia and spaghetti western genres and is the first of He Ping's thematic trilogy set in western China, followed by Sun Valley and Warriors of Heaven and Earth.
